Building permits are an important aspect of the development and renovation course of, acting as a legal requirement that ensures compliance with native codes and laws. When an individual or a business plans to undertake any construction, they need to search approval from the local authorities. This course of not only protects public safety but additionally helps maintain the structural integrity of buildings in the surrounding group.
The application for a building permit requires detailed plans that define the proposed work. These plans embrace architectural designs, structural concerns, and sometimes environmental impacts. When crammed out accurately, the permit application helps local officials understand each the scope of the project and its implications for the neighborhood.
Upon submission, relevant authorities will evaluation the applying to ensure it aligns with zoning legal guidelines, safety standards, and different rules - Local demolition services offered Calabasas, CA. This review course of typically contains checking for adherence to building codes that dictate the minimal requirements for construction practices. Local codes make certain that constructions are safe and habitable, stopping potential hazards such as fireplace risk or structural weak spot

Once the application is permitted, a building permit is issued. This doc grants permission to start construction whereas additionally outlining what can and can't be done. It serves as a guideline for both the contractors concerned and the inspectors who will later verify that the project adheres to the permitted plans.
During construction, ongoing inspections might be required to monitor compliance with the permit situations. These inspections can cover various elements, together with plumbing methods, electrical installations, and structural integrity. Ensuring adherence to the permit throughout the construction course of minimizes the risk of future complications, each for the builder and the occupants.

Failing to acquire or comply with a building permit can lead to severe consequences, together with fines, cessation of work, or even authorized actions. Local governments have the authority to enforce building codes rigorously, which may include requiring the demolition of a structure that was constructed without proper permits. This unpredictability makes it important for anyone contemplating construction to prioritize acquiring their permits.
The costs related to building permits can differ broadly, depending on the project's measurement, sort, and placement. Fees are often tiered based mostly on specific standards, making it essential for homeowners and contractors to know the breakdown. Additionally, some localities might offer assets or charge waivers to encourage certain types of improvement, such as affordable housing initiatives.
In many cases, building permits can even have an impact on the overall timeline of a project. For those planning to build or renovate, understanding the permitting course of is vital. Delays in permit approval can push again begin dates, which, in flip, can affect every thing from scheduling contractors to budgeting for costs.
Moreover, partaking with the neighborhood is usually an integral part of the permit course of. Public hearings may occur, throughout which neighbors can express their concerns or help for a project. This added layer of enter helps to take care of the character of current neighborhoods and fosters goodwill amongst future neighbors.

Building permits usually are not solely for model new construction but additionally cover renovations, repairs, and even certain alterations to current constructions. Whether it's including a deck, ending a basement, or altering the outside facade, acquiring the best permits ensures that these modifications adjust to present legal guidelines and requirements.
In many regions, there are different varieties of permits primarily based on various standards. These can embrace common building permits, electrical permits, plumbing permits, and more, every with its personal application necessities and processes. What is a building permit and why do I want one?
A building permit is an official approval issued by your local authorities that allows you to proceed with construction or renovation projects. It ensures that your project adheres to local zoning laws, building codes, and safety regulations. Obtaining a permit is crucial to avoid authorized issues and potential fines.

How do I apply for a building permit?
To apply for a building permit, you want to submit an utility kind together with detailed plans of your project to your local building division. This may include architectural drawings and structural calculations (Consultation for home remodeling projects Reseda, CA). It's necessary to verify the particular requirements of your municipality, as they can range
How lengthy does it take to get a building permit?
The timeframe for acquiring a building permit can differ widely based on your location, the complexity of the project, and the amount of purposes the building department is handling. Generally, it can take anyplace from a few days to several weeks. Planning ahead may help keep away from any unnecessary delays.

What happens through the building permit evaluate process?
During the building permit review process, your submitted plans and application will be evaluated by local officials to ensure compliance with building codes, zoning laws, and safety requirements. They might request changes or further info earlier than deciding whether or not to approve or deny the permit.

Are there fees related to obtaining a building permit?
Yes, most jurisdictions charge a charge for processing building permit functions. The amount can depend on the sort of project, its size, and native regulations. It's advisable to inquire about the total prices involved when submitting your software to avoid surprises.
What are the consequences of not having a building permit?
Failure to obtain a building permit can lead to fines, pressured removal of unpermitted work, or authorized motion. Additionally, not having a permit can complicate future property transactions and affect insurance protection, as unpermitted work could not meet safety standards.

Can I work without a building permit on minor repairs?
It is determined by your native regulations. Some jurisdictions permit minor repairs and maintenance tasks to be carried out without a permit. However, it’s crucial to confirm with your native building authority to make sure compliance and keep away from potential issues.

What ought to I do if my building permit is denied?
If your building permit is denied, you will obtain a discover outlining the reasons for the denial. You can right the problems identified, revise your plans accordingly, and reapply. Alternatively, you might additionally enchantment the choice, depending on native laws.
